Director, Engineering, Starbucks Technology
Job Summary and Mission:
Starbucks continues to offer the largest and most robust mobile ecosystem of any retailer in the world, with more than 13.5 million Starbucks Rewards members, eight million mobile paying customers, with one out of three now using Mobile Order & Pay, and more than $6 billion loaded onto prepaid Starbucks Cards in North America during 2016 alone. But that’s still only a small percentage of our monthly customers in the US and around the world. Come join the team that is building out our new performant, multi-tenant cloud commerce engine that will be used by hundreds of millions of customers and partners across hundreds of thousands of stores, spanning over 75 countries. In this role, you will lead an Engineering organization that will design, develop and deliver the technology that enables this growth.
The unified commerce platform (UCP) is our first multi-tenant cloud commerce engine, supporting company owned stores and equity partners around the world, and enabling us to take our Loyalty, Mobile Ordering and Payment digital experiences to the next level. Built on a next-generation architecture, UCP will enable faster go-to-market for new digital capabilities and be a key enabler in delivering a simplified global technology architecture.
